Intergas 2 Fault Code: Causes, Fixes & Repair Costs

What does the Intergas 2 fault code mean?

Intergas fault code 2 appears when the boiler's control board detects that the two water temperature sensors — S1 (flow) and S2 (return) — are giving readings that don't match their expected positions. The S1 sensor sits at the top of the heat exchanger and monitors the temperature of water leaving the boiler, while S2 sits at the bottom and tracks the temperature of water returning from your radiators. When the PCB sees the return temperature reading higher than the flow temperature, or otherwise detects that the sensors appear to be the wrong way around, it raises fault code 2 and locks the boiler out as a safety precaution. This is almost always caused by the sensors being physically or electrically transposed, though wiring faults or a failed sensor can produce the same symptom.

How to fix it

  1. Attempt a single boiler reset DIY safe

    On most Intergas models a flashing LED above the key symbol alongside the fault code indicates a lockout. Press and hold the key/reset button as described in your user guide to attempt a restart. Only do this once or twice — if the boiler locks out again immediately, a reset alone will not resolve the underlying problem and you should move on to the next steps.

  2. Check the boiler's recent service history DIY safe

    Think back to whether the boiler was recently serviced, had a repair carried out, or had any components replaced. Fault code 2 appearing shortly after an engineer visit strongly suggests the S1 and S2 sensor connectors were accidentally swapped during reassembly. Note this down to tell the next engineer — it helps them go straight to the likely cause.

  3. Have a Gas Safe engineer inspect and verify the sensor wiring loom Gas Safe engineer

    An engineer will open the boiler casing and check that the S1 connector is attached at the top of the heat exchanger and S2 at the bottom, as specified for the Intergas wiring layout. If they find the connectors are reversed, swapping them back is a quick fix that should clear the fault immediately.

  4. Have the engineer test S1 and S2 with a multimeter Gas Safe engineer

    If the wiring is found to be correct, the engineer will measure the resistance of each NTC thermistor at the known water temperature and compare the readings against Intergas's resistance-temperature table. A sensor reading outside tolerance confirms it has failed and needs replacing, rather than just being wrongly connected.

  5. Replace the faulty sensor with a genuine Intergas part Gas Safe engineer

    Intergas recommends using the genuine NTC sensor (part number 200117) for both the S1 and S2 positions. Using genuine parts helps protect any remaining manufacturer warranty on your boiler and ensures the sensor's resistance characteristics match what the PCB expects.

  6. Reset the boiler after repairs and confirm normal operation Gas Safe engineer

    Once the engineer has corrected the wiring or fitted a replacement sensor, they will reset the boiler and monitor it through a full heating cycle to confirm the flow and return temperatures are reading correctly and that fault code 2 does not return.

  7. If the fault persists, have the PCB investigated Gas Safe engineer

    Should the fault code 2 reappear after confirmed correct wiring and known-good sensors, the PCB's sensor input circuitry may be the culprit. A Gas Safe engineer with Intergas experience can advise on PCB testing or replacement. PCB replacement is a more significant cost, so engineers will typically rule out all other causes first.

Typical repair cost

Expect to pay roughly £100–£250, depending on the underlying cause.

Frequently asked questions

Can I fix Intergas fault code 2 myself by swapping the sensors back?

No — and it is important not to attempt this. Accessing the sensor connectors inside the boiler requires opening the casing and working on internal components, which must only be done by a Gas Safe registered engineer. The only safe homeowner action is a single reset attempt. If the fault returns, call an engineer. You can verify any engineer's Gas Safe registration at gassaferegister.co.uk using the number on the back of their ID card.

How much does it cost to fix fault code 2 on an Intergas boiler?

For most people, the repair falls between £100 and £250 in total. If the fix is simply reconnecting the sensors the right way around, you will mainly be paying the engineer's call-out and labour fee. If a sensor has actually failed, the genuine Intergas NTC sensor (part 200117) is relatively inexpensive — typically £15–£40 for the part — so the total bill remains modest. If the PCB turns out to be the root cause, costs rise considerably, often £350–£500 including labour, so engineers will always rule out simpler causes first.

Why does fault code 2 often appear straight after a service?

Intergas uses the same NTC sensor (part 200117) for both the S1 (flow) and S2 (return) positions on the heat exchanger, meaning the two connectors look identical and fit either location. During a service or repair the heat exchanger is often disconnected, and it is straightforward to reconnect the two sensor plugs the wrong way around by mistake. The boiler runs briefly, the PCB detects the temperature readings are back to front, and fault code 2 is triggered. The fix in this case is quick — the engineer simply swaps the connectors to their correct positions.

Will fault code 2 affect my Intergas warranty?

Intergas boilers typically come with a warranty ranging from 12 months up to 10 years depending on the model and registration. To keep the warranty valid, the boiler must be serviced annually by a qualified engineer and only genuine Intergas parts should be fitted. If the fault arose from incorrect work by an engineer, you may have recourse to them directly. Check your warranty documentation or contact Intergas UK for guidance specific to your model and installation date.
